Growth Performance of Tetrapleura Tetraptera (Schum and Thonn) Seedlings to Green Manure and Inorganic Fertilizer

The use, types and method of fertilizers for agricultural and forest plants should be sustainable, ecofriendly and natural to the environment. Application of green manure is being used nowadays for soil nutrient management, growth and plant yields because of their natural effects. This study investigated the use of green manure andinorganicfertilizer on the growth performance of Tetrapleura tetraptera. Topsoil, leucaenana leucoephala (leave powder) and inorganic fertilizer (NPK 15: 15:15) were used. The fertilizer were weighed and applied to the 5kg of soils at 0g, 10g and 20g each and were replicated six times. Growth parameters such as seedling heights, number of leaf and stem diameter were assessed weekly for aperiod of three months. The application leucaenana leucoephala’s leave powder as green manure showed significantly high effects on the growth parametersof Tetrapleura tetraptera seedlings at p ≤ 0.05. This study has shown the efficacy of leucaenana leucoephala’s leave powder as green manure for optimum growth of Tetrapleura tetraptera seedlings.
